The PTO Link® Compact System is designed for ONLY category 1 tractors (compact or subcompact, with a max 70 HP/engine net rating), used in combination with category 1 implements ONLY. PTO Link® is the original, universal PTO quick-connect system consisting of two interconnecting steel couplers. Its patented Open-Plate design replaces the traditional spline-to-driveline connection with a visible interface that’s both easy to see and reach. Now you can quickly and safely connect/disconnect implements at the tractor’s PTO in just seconds! This complete PTO Link® System includes both a Tractor (Female) Coupler and an Implement (Male) Coupler. For best results, every tractor should be equipped with a Tractor Coupler, and every implement should be equipped with an Implement Coupler!

Safety and Operation:

  • The PTO Link® System adds approximately 5 inches to the overall length of the implement driveline when fully installed. To avoid any possible damage or injury requires carefully measuring the driveline length for possible adjustments and reviewing all installation instructions and operational specs before operating the PTO Link®.
  • The PTO Link® Compact System is NOT compatible or interchangeable with other PTO Link® systems due to the specific design of the connecting components for each system.
  • As an essential safety precaution, be sure to turn off the tractor’s engine during installation, shield any rotating parts, and do not wear any loose clothing that could become entangled and pulled into the machine. PTO safety is critical, and every precaution should be taken.
  • The PTO Link® system is NOT an adapter. To comply with ASABE standards, do not use PTO Link® in combination with PTO adapters.

Choosing the right PTO adapter means matching splines, diameter, and power ratings between your tractor and implement: measure both shafts' spline count and diameter (e.g., 1-3/8" 6-spline vs. 1-1/8" 6-spline) and pick an adapter that converts one to the other, making sure its horsepower rating exceeds your tractor's PTO output—opting for heavy-duty, bolt-on designs over quick-attach pins for high-horsepower or heavy-load work. If you swap implements often, a product like PTO Link uses a patented quick-connect system that lets you attach an implement in seconds without tools, available for tractors up to 130 HP (though it's a connect system rather than a true adapter, so it shouldn't be combined with standard PTO adapters). For older tractors paired with modern rotary cutters, use an Over-Running Coupler to prevent implement inertia from pushing the tractor forward, and favor hardened steel construction and proper lubrication for durability.
